Default Need help with Tekin FX-R

I have a HaVoc Bully MOA. My ON/Off switch to the rig is on all the time. Will not shut off.. The wiring to the motors, BEC and PK4 receiver all look right. When the battery is connected everything works right. Again my problem is I have to plug/unplug the battery because the Tekin on/off switch is on all the time. Once the battery is plugged in the rig works great. That is untill I unplug it to turn off the rig. Any ideas????

sounds like there is a faulty switch of course, you can replace the switch or send it to tekin to get it done, theres alot of guys who who take the switch right off and solder the wires togeather so you have to unplug to turn it off. Its better to always unplug your battery when your not useing the crawler, so i dont really see it as a big deal.

check the wire's at the switch[inside plastic cover] they have been known to touch, if that's not it contact tekin they have great service. ya beat me to it monkey

You are using a bec so the receiver & servo power is bypassing the switch. You need to unplug the battery to turn them off no matter if the switch works or not. I just leave the switches on and plug/unplug the battery. The way it should be done anyway.
